Summary
Keywords
Civil procedure — Pleadings — Striking out — Intellectual property — Copyright — Reproduction of all or part of work not alleged — Case management judge granting motions to strike — Appeal courts upholding findings made in course of proceedings — Whether application for leave to appeal raises question of public importance.<br>
Summary
Case summaries are prepared by the Office of the Registrar of the Supreme Court of Canada (Law Branch). Please note that summaries are not provided to the Judges of the Court. They are placed on the Court file and website for information purposes only.
In March 2020, the applicant brought an action claiming significant amounts for infringement of the copyright he allegedly had in connection with the development of plans for a real estate project. The three respondents in turn filed motions to strike under Rule 221(1) of the Federal Courts Rules, SOR/98-106. The case management judge granted the motions and declined to give the applicant leave to amend his statement of claim. She was of the opinion that the applicant had not alleged that the respondents had reproduced all or any substantial part of the copyrighted work. The Federal Court and the Federal Court of Appeal agreed with that finding and held on appeal that the applicant had not clearly identified a reviewable error by the case management judge that warranted their intervention.
